JOB DESCRIPTION FOR E-COMMERCE / SALES ADMIN / AMAZON EXPERT
Sales Administrators provide administrative support to sales teams.
Their duties include answering the phone and replying to emails, scheduling appointments, keeping sales records, and preparing sales contracts andagreements. They may be required to research potential customers and sales strategies.
